In this guest post by Pam Hubler, she shares how she developed and implemented Google Challenges to deliver Virtual PD at her school. Virtual PD, or virtual professional learning, is more than just making things digital.

7 Ways to Spark Innovation and Collaboration In Your School

MSEDTechie

Innovators make learning relevant, and they commit to sharing digital learning content and powerful ideas for improving teaching and learning. Some teachers engage in creative learning spaces with makerspaces, some create “classrooms without walls” via social media), and some explore virtual and augmented reality.
